Explain in a complete sentence how to tell the difference between the power of power and the power of product rule. Please help
german

Answer:


Step-by-step explanation:

The power of a power rule is when power is raised to another power. (x^n)^m.  when you do this rule, you must multiply the exponents so, x^nm or x^n*m.

The product rule for exponents is used when there are multiple terms that are raised by an exponent that have the same base and ae being multiplied. x^3 * x^2. To solve this, you keep the base (x) and add the two exponents together (3 and 2) so, x^3+2 = x^5.
